Falcons head coach Raheem Morris said on Wednesday that the team’s approach to playing time during the preseason is still being decided, but more clarity has been provided for the rookie class ahead of Friday’s first preseason game against the Detroit Lions.

Earlier in the week, Morris confirmed that quarterbacks Michael Penix Jr. and Kirk Cousins will not participate in Friday’s game. The rest of the lineup and playing time decisions will be determined after Wednesday’s team scrimmage, based on how much work starters and key rotational players complete during practice.

Morris explained there is a plan to feature younger players throughout the preseason, with an emphasis on rookies in the opening matchup. This includes edge rusher Jalon Walker and safety Xavier Watts, who have both had limited participation recently due to injuries.

“When you come back from those hamstring (injuries) those back-to-back days can kind of get you, so we are trying to avoid those things,” Morris said about Walker. “But Walker is a guy who will get significant amount of work (Wednesday) in the scrimmage and he will get some within the game setting (Friday), too.”

Watts is reportedly ahead of Walker in his recovery from an undisclosed injury. He is also expected to play on Friday.

The number of series that rookies will play has not been finalized, according to Morris. However, other first-year players such as James Pearce Jr. and Billy Bowman Jr. are also likely to see action against Detroit. While not specifically named by Morris during Wednesday’s remarks, he referenced Pearce earlier in the week during an interview with NFL Network.

“You talk about your rookie class, getting them out there — even with Mike (Penix) out there last year, getting him out there even a little bit just to get used to what it feels like,” Morris said alluding to Penix’s slight work in the 2024 preseason. “… We will get those guys out there for a couple series to get them a feel for it.”

The Falcons are scheduled to host the Lions at Mercedes-Benz Stadium on Friday at 7 p.m. ET.
